How Does The Chiller Temperature Accuracy Affect The Laser’s Performance?

Lasers produce a copious amount of heat during their operation. And to get the best performance, high precision temperature control is a vital characteristic to maintain. External cooling in lasers is frequently used in industrial production. They help maintain or even improve laser performance. Fan-cooled lasers exist. Precise Temperature Control for All-Solid-State UV Lasers Using Miniature DC Compressor Systems: A Novel Approach

Abstract Temperature stability is crucial for the performance of all-solid-state ultraviolet (UV) lasers, influencing their output characteristics and efficiency. This paper presents an innovative temperature control system employing a vapor compression type DC inverter refrigeration system coupled with electrothermal compensation.
